Water in Brandon

Brandon sits east of the metro along I-20, with Crossgates and Castlewoods filling in between town and the south shore of the Ross Barnett Reservoir. It is a real mix out here: established subdivisions on city water and plenty of homes on private wells once you get past the developed core along MS-18.

On the well side, iron staining and that rotten-egg sulfur smell are the usual complaints, and they need oxidizing filtration sized to the water. On city supply, hardness and chlorine taste are the common ones, handled with softening and carbon filtration. Every Brandon job starts with a test so we treat what you actually have.

What are the most common water problems in Brandon, MS?

Around Brandon (Rankin County), the usual issues are hardness scale, chlorine taste on city supply, and iron, sulfur, or sediment on wells. We confirm which apply to your home with a test before recommending anything.
